Highland Park Suspect's Past Littered With Red Flags - Morning Joe - MSNBC



The Morning Joe panel continues its discussion on the Highland Park July 4 shooting and the need for restrictions on assault-style weapons. Former Senator Claire McCaskill weighs in on Minority Leader Mitch McConnell's claim that these mass shootings are "indications of a mental health problem." Aired on 07/06/2022.

Say, when oppositional defiant disorder is first apparent.

And the entire family must be involved.

It is home-based, intense, time consuming, and there must be a willingness to change.

Without this, ODD morphs into conduct disorder and, frequently, anti-social PD. No effective treatment for personality disorders because the PD is so inextricably intertwined with who the person is.
